Intuit's TV spots have stated Block advertises that applicants hired as tax season employees need no tax preparation experience. The ads also focus on couples who meet a plumber and a retail store clerk who had prepared their returns. Block claimed the ads left a false impressed that its preparers were not well trained, nor were they tax experts.
The federal court in Kansas City, Mo., denied Block's motion for a temporary restraining order that would have halted the Intuit ads.
A federal court has rejected the effort by H&R Block to force Intuit to withdraw two TurboTax television advertisements. Block had claimed the ads were misleading and also that Intuit had infringed on the tax store chain's trademark.
